塞贡热浪:在炎热的环境中,

首府居民在社区支持和机智的帮助下, 抵御极端气温
尽管面临高达41摄氏度的高温, 城市居民们采取各种策略保持凉爽和水分, 从耐受炎热太阳的建筑工人到穿过炎热街道的废品收集者. 建筑工地的工作人员全身遮盖,寻找阴凉的地方,不断补水以抵御极度炎热. 尽管极端天气带来了挑战, 社区团结的光照耀着当地人在首都街道上免费提供冰茶, 其他居民正在采取积极措施减轻炎热的影响, 住在顶租房对居民来说是个额外的挑战, 尽管预报显示南方的炎热天气将持续, 通过团结和创造力,
